Hasan plans to choose a book from a section of the store where everything is 25% off. he writes the expression d−0.25d to find the sale price of the book if the original price is d dollars. bella correctly writes another expression, 0.75d , that will also find the sale price of the book if the original price is d dollars. use the drop-down menus to explain what each part of hasan's and bella's expressions mean.

Respuesta :

Given:
discount of 25%

Hasan's equation:  d - 0.25d
Bella's equation: 0.75d

d represents the original price.
0.25d represents the discount.
0.75d represents the discounted price.

Example: 1,000 is the price. d = 1,000
0.25d = 0.25(1000) = 250 this is the discount
0.75d = 0.75(1000) = 750 this is the discounted price

Hassan: d - 0.25d =  1000 - 250 = 750
Bella: 0.75d = 0.75(1000) = 750
